Masaba Gupta's Meal Is Everything Tasty And Healthy

Masaba shared the picture of her nutrient-loaded meal on Instagram stories and captioned it: "Let food be thy medicine". The plate had a protein-rich salad mix of kidney beans, chickpeas, tomatoes and cucumber. The salad was paired with sauteed broccoli, dal salad and a greenside dish that looked like boiled spinach.

Amazon is hosting Great Foodie Fest in Bengaluru

The 10-day long food festival will begin on March 26 and it will go on until April 4. During the food festival, customers in Bengaluru can enjoy deals and cashback on orders from popular restaurants and cloud kitchens around them with convenient doorstep delivery.

Reusable Tableware Could Resolve China’s Plastic Problem

A faculty research fellow at the University of Groningen, Shan and his colleagues compared disposable paper-based products and silicone ones that could be continuously shared after eateries or a central facility gathered and washed them between every use.

Unexpected food pairings go viral

Mussels with strawberries, lamb with cinnamon or asparagus with grapes. Dipping French fries into a milkshake, oysters with kiwi or broccoli with almonds and lemon zest and bacon espuma are unexpected food pairings that went viral.

How artificial intelligence is helping make food production smarter

Using artificial intelligence, machine learning algorithms and digital technology, the data is automatically processed and linked, which involves analysing the production data from a particular company, comparing it with data from other producers and then combining the results with the outcomes from other analyses.

Food fraud: an increasing concern within the beverage sector

In a survey of 100 senior executives across the beverage sector, 97 per cent reported that they have been affected by food fraud in the past 12 months, while 80 per cent agree that food fraud is a growing concern for their business.

Scientist Are Making Mock Meat Out Of Air And Soil - Find How

South Indian actor Samantha Ruth Prabhu, who follows a plant-based diet, recently took to her Instagram handle to share a story featuring scientists in Finland making meat-free schnitzel from air and soil. For the unversed, schnitzel is basically meat fried in fat.
